I have one of these so called magnet things supper glued to my lowering link. Some lights change for me some don't, and seeing as I'm in a new city there is nothing to say that the lights that do change would have done so even if I didn't have the magnet. The sensors here are magnetic, and I was taught from the MSF to try to place as much of the bike on the open slits (covered by road tar) because this is where they bury the electronic wire.
Mine was free, but I would say for the hit and miss aspect of this thing to just run the light if it only happens to you every once and a while and keep the $10.00, Gas is expensive.
